Ralcorp Purchase Turns ConAgra Into Packaged Food Giant

ConAgra will pay $5 billion in cash to acquire Ralcorp Holdings, becoming North America's largest packaged food private label.

McGraw-Hill Finally Hocks Education Division

McGraw-Hill has agreed to sell its educational division to Apollo Global Management for $2.5 billion.
